A "pure" Atlas missile boat with a 325 STD, 35ALRMs, TAG, and a Medium Laser
And, to be fair and honest to you and Void, I have actually seen this exact build in PUG matches from time to time, and it generally seemed to preform poorly.
The point isn't that it can't be done, but rather that it honestly would be a build better served on other chassis. (As stated before already.)

This Atlas build is one such case. I don't recommend it, for many reasons. That doesn't mean you can't play it if it is working for you. I just feel that one could do better with a different build. (Such as fewer LRM racks, more direct fire weapons. Atlases can work very well with LRMs, just not as an LRM dedicated boat. And I see boating as when most all of your weapons are of one type.)
